Minutes — Management Meeting, Corvalen Group. Attendees reviewed the quarterly cash-flow forecast for all branches. Ms. Tarlow noted collections in the Ridgefen branch improved, while the Ashmoor branch remains behind plan. Branch managers are asked to submit updated receivables aging by Friday. Capital purchases above threshold require head-office sign-off this quarter. The confidential note below gives the underlying rationale:

confidential, fahag-yahap: Project Raleth slips by six weeks because of the tooling delay.

// Queue-depth autoscaler client for the Burrowmill pipeline.
// Quick orientation: this polls the internal Gaugewell service every
// 20s and scales workers when depth crosses the thresholds in
// scaling.yml. Don't lower the poll interval — Gaugewell rate-limits
// hard and you'll get starved, which looks like a scaling freeze.
// The client authenticates to Gaugewell with the key that follows.

gateway credential: kto2_aa

### Changelog: ContrastKit defaults updated

Welcome aboard! Quick heads-up: ContrastKit, our color-contrast audit tool, changed its defaults this release. The minimum ratio check now targets the stricter tier out of the box, large-text exemptions are narrower, and audits fail the build instead of just warning. If a legacy project breaks, don't panic — overrides still work per-repo. The new defaults ship as the following configuration values.

deployment values, yadug-bawif:
[framir]
team = pelox
access_code = ac_a38ab2
owner = tamion.julael
host = framir.tolvaqlabs.test
port = 11211
peer = tammir.zemvargrid.local
salt = 2215ef03
pin = 1541

Every tile you request passes through Cachewarren, our rendering cache layer, which stores rasterized tiles keyed by zoom, coordinates, and style hash. Respect the cache headers returned by Cachewarren; re-requesting unchanged tiles wastes render capacity and may throttle your plugin. For development, point your plugin at the staging endpoint, which mirrors production behavior with relaxed limits. Requests to the staging cache must be authenticated, and the key you should use is provided directly below.

gateway credential: kto23_LX9A4ys6i4nzHtpOLNLodKK